嵌入式系统软件体系结构动态建模及应用研究

摘    要:应用π演算方法,结合Petri网中的面向对象Petri网和时间Petri网,建立了嵌入式系统软件体系结构抽象模型ESAM,研究了ESAM模型的动态演化、一致性和死锁。应用ESAM抽象模型,对车站信号联锁控制器进行了建模与分析。

Dynamic modeling and application research of embedded system software architecture

Abstract:Applyingπ-calculus methods and combing the Object-oriented Petri Nets (OPN) and Time Petri Nets (TPN) of the Petri nets theories, embedded-systems software-architecture abstract model(ESAM)was established. And then, dynamic evolving, uniformity and deadlock of the ESAM model were researched. Last, the developed model was used to model and analyze the signal interlocking controller of railway station.
